OBJECTIVE
Determine locoregional diagnostic yield of 4-site screening (head, neck, chest, and abdomen) to diagnose metastatic disease or clinically significant comorbid diseases in dogs with oral cancer.
ANIMALS
381 dogs with histologically confirmed oral tumors.
METHODS
Medical records from 381 dogs with histologically confirmed oral tumors that underwent preoperative screening were retrospectively reviewed.
RESULTS
Skull and neck CT scan was performed on 348 patients. Bone lysis was present in 74.4% of tumors. Oral squamous cell carcinoma, sarcomas, and T2-T3 (> 2 cm) tumors had a significantly (P < .05) increased incidence of lysis compared to odontogenic and T1 (< 2 cm) tumors, respectively. Minor incidental findings were present in 60.6% of CT scans. Major incidental findings were found in 4.6% of scans. The risk of diagnosing an incidental finding increased by 10% and 20% per year of age for minor and major findings, respectively. Lymph node metastasis was diagnosed with CT or cytology in 7.5% of cases (10.7% of nonodontogenic tumors, 0% of odontogenic tumors). Oral malignant melanoma, oral squamous cell carcinoma, and T3 tumors had the highest prevalence of metastatic disease at the time of staging. The presence of bone lysis was not associated with cervical metastasis.
CLINICAL RELEVANCE
Major incidental findings were rare (< 5%) but primarily included secondary extraoral tumors. Lymphatic metastasis was diagnosed in 10.7% of nonodontogenic tumors, but cytology was not performed in the majority of cases and often included only a single mandibular node. Therefore, these results likely underestimate the incidence of lymphatic metastasis. Guided lymph node sampling is highly recommended, especially for oral malignant melanoma, squamous cell carcinoma, and T2-T3 tumors.

Odontogenic tumors (OGTs), which originate from cells of odontogenic apparatus and their remnants, are rare entities. Primary intraosseous carcinoma NOS (PIOC), is one of the OGTs, but it is even rarer and has a worse prognosis. The precise characteristics of PIOC, especially in immunohistochemical features and its pathogenesis, remain unclear. We characterized a case of PIOC arising from the left mandible, in which histopathological findings showed a transition from the odontogenic keratocyst to the carcinoma. Remarkably, the tumor lesion of this PIOC prominently exhibits malignant attributes, including invasive growth of carcinoma cell infiltration into the bone tissue, an elevated Ki-67 index, and lower signal for CK13 and higher signal for CK17 compared with the non-tumor region, histopathologically and immunohistopathologically. Further immunohistochemical analyses demonstrated increased expression of ADP-ribosylation factor (ARF)-like 4c (ARL4C) (accompanying expression of β-catenin in the nucleus) and yes-associated protein (YAP) in the tumor lesion. On the other hand, YAP was expressed and the expression of ARL4C was hardly detected in the non-tumor region. In addition, quantitative RT-PCR analysis using RNAs and dot blot analysis using genomic DNA showed the activation of Wnt/β-catenin signaling and epigenetic alterations, such as an increase of 5mC levels and a decrease of 5hmC levels, in the tumor lesion. A DNA microarray and a gene set enrichment analysis demonstrated that various types of intracellular signaling would be activated and several kinds of cellular functions would be altered in the pathogenesis of PIOC. Experiments with the GSK-3 inhibitor revealed that β-catenin pathway increased not only mRNA levels of ankyrin repeat domain1 (ANKRD1) but also protein levels of YAP and transcriptional co-activator with PDZ-binding motif (TAZ) in oral squamous cell carcinoma cell lines. These results suggested that further activation of YAP signaling by Wnt/β-catenin signaling may be associated with the pathogenesis of PIOC deriving from odontogenic keratocyst in which YAP signaling is activated.

Ameloblastoma is the most common benign odontogenic tumor with local invasion and high recurrence, which generally occurs in the jaw bones. Hypercalcemia is a common paraneoplastic syndrome that is commonly observed in patients with malignancies but rarely encountered in patients with benign tumors. Thus far, not many cases of ameloblastoma with hypercalcemia have been reported, and the pathogenic mechanism has not been studied in depth. This paper presents a case report of a 26-year-old male diagnosed with giant ameloblastoma of the mandible, accompanied by rare hypercalcemia. Additionally, a review of the relevant literature is conducted. This patient initially underwent marsupialization, yet this treatment was not effective, which indicated that the selection of the appropriate operation is of prime importance for improving the prognosis of patients with ameloblastoma. The tumor not only failed to shrink but gradually increased in size, accompanied by multiple complications including hypercalcemia, renal dysfunction, anemia, and cachexia. Due to the contradiction between the necessity of tumor resection and the patient's poor systemic condition, we implemented a multi-disciplinary team (MDT) meeting to better evaluate this patient's condition and design an individualized treatment strategy. The patient subsequently received a variety of interventions to improve the general conditions until he could tolerate surgery, and finally underwent the successful resection of giant ameloblastoma and reconstruction with vascularized fibular flap. No tumor recurrence or distance metastasis was observed during 5 years of follow-up. Additionally, the absence of hypercalcemia recurrence was also noted.

BACKGROUND
Unicystic ameloblastoma is a rare, benign, locally invasive odontogenic neoplasm of young age that shows clinical, radiographic, or gross features of an odontogenic cyst but histologically shows typical ameloblastomatous epithelium lining part of the cyst cavity, with or without luminal and/or mural tumor growth.
AIM
To report a case of an asymptomatic unicystic ameloblastoma in a 12-year-old child, along with its management and follow-up.
CASE DESCRIPTION
A 12-year-old boy presented with swelling with respect to the left body of the mandible. The orthopantomogram (OPG) and computed tomography scan revealed a large unilocular radiolucency in the left mandible associated with the primary second mandibular molar. Complete enucleation of the cyst and extraction of the associated primary teeth and underlying permanent teeth were done under general anesthesia. Carnoy's solution was applied in the bone cavity for 3 minutes with cotton applicators. Postoperative healing was uneventful. Prosthetic rehabilitation was done during the follow-up period.
CONCLUSION
Unicystic ameloblastoma is rarely seen in younger children, so a pediatric dentist must be cautious while diagnosing an intraoral swelling. Timely intervention and conservative surgical treatment, along with a proper follow-up, improved the treatment outcome and prevented potential complications in the future.
CLINICAL SIGNIFICANCE
This report highlights the salient features of unicystic ameloblastoma to be able to accurately diagnose and manage the lesion.

An adenomatoid odontogenic tumor (AOT) is a benign epithelial lesion, being the fourth most common among all odontogenic tumors. Usually presents as slow painless growth that sometimes leads to facial asymmetry. Many cases are detected by radiographic studies, and the indication for biopsy and surgery is secondary to this finding. We report a case of a 17-year-old man with a history of left mandibular painless swelling since 4 months ago, associated with facial asymmetry and hard consistency. An imaging study showed an extensive unilocular radiolucent lesion to the basilar arch, with defined limits and with peripheral hyperdense areas located only vestibular to the lesion. The histopathology was composed of odontogenic epithelial cell proliferation, with epithelial nodular and duct-like structures, rosettes of spindled epithelial cells with eosinophilic material, calcifications, and fibro-osseous reaction. Surgical conservative excision including the affected tooth is the treatment of choice and recurrence is rare. The histologic findings of reactive fibro-osseous proliferation in AOT should be interpreted as a reactive change in the tumor capsule and not as an adnexal lesion. We present an atypical case of AOT with reactive fibro-osseous reaction. Despite clinical aggressive behavior, conservative surgical treatment could be the treatment of choice. Additionally, we emphasize the importance of histopathological examination together with the imaging study of radiolucent lesions of the maxillary bones. BACKGROUND
Adenoid ameloblastoma with dentinoid (AAD) is a hybrid odontogenic tumor comprising histopathological presentation of ameloblastoma (AM) and adenomatoid odontogenic tumor (AOT) along with extracellular dentinoid material.
CASE PRESENTATION
A 35-year-old female reported an asymptomatic swelling in the left mandibular posterior region. Histopathological examination revealed composite features of AM with AOT along with dentinoid material, which stained positively with Van Gieson and trichrome stains.
CONCLUSION
The present case report serves to add further to the modicum of literature reports pertaining to AAD, which may gain recognition as a distinct entity in future World Health Organization (WHO) classification of odontogenic tumors.

BACKGROUND
Secreted protein acidic and rich in cysteine (SPARC) has been shown to modulate aggressive behavior in several benign and malignant tumors. Little is known about SPARC expression in odontogenic keratocyst (OKC), an odontogenic cyst with an aggressive nature. To the best of our knowledge, only one study has been investigated the expression of this protein in OKCs. This study aimed to characterize SPARC expression in OKCs. Additionally, to determine whether SPARC is associated with aggressive behavior in OKCs, SPARC expression in OKCs was compared with radicular cysts (RCs), dentigerous cysts (DCs) and calcifying odontogenic cysts (COCs). These odontogenic cysts showed no or less aggressive behavior.
METHODS
SPARC expression was evaluated in 38 OKCs, 39 RCs, 35 DCs and 14 COCs using immunohistochemistry. The percentages of positive cells and the intensities of immunostaining in the epithelial lining and the cystic wall were evaluated and scored.
RESULTS
Generally, OKCs showed similar staining patterns to RCs, DCs and COCs. In the epithelial lining, SPARC was not detected, except for ghost cells in all COCs. In the cystic wall, the majority of positive cells were fibroblasts. Compared between 4 groups of odontogenic cysts, SPARC expression in OKCs was significantly higher than those of RCs (P < 0.001), DCs (P < 0.001) and COCs (P = 0.001).
CONCLUSIONS
A significant increase of SPARC expression in OKCs compared with RCs, DCs and COCs suggests that SPARC may play a role in the aggressive behavior of OKCs.

OBJECTIVE
The objective of this study was to identify the degree of perception of oral pathology as a specialty among the general pathologists and the need of utilizing oral pathologists in assisting to identify oral lesions in diagnostic challenges.
METHODS
A questionnaire-based survey was conducted among qualified general pathologists to collect the data. The survey items focused on various aspects, including the analysis of oral pathology as a specialty, the importance of employing oral pathologists for identifying oral lesions in diagnostic challenges, and the difficulties encountered in managing such lesions. The data collected was analyzed using descriptive and inferential statistics. For comparing the relationship between work experience and the referral of odontogenic cysts and tumors cases, a Chi-square test was employed. A significance level of ⩽ 0.05 was deemed as statistically significant.
RESULTS
Two hundred and fifty general pathologists responded to the questionnaire. Two hundred and thirty two (92.8%) participants showed awareness of oral pathology as a specialty. For the diagnosis of oral, jaws, and salivary glands pathologic lesions, the majority 198 (79.2%) respondents believed that oral pathologists are required for the diagnosis. Regarding the referrals of lesions to oral pathologists, 137 (54.8%), participants did not refer. In terms of training in oral pathology, all of the participants agreed that they would undertake short-term posting in oral pathology. For challenging cases, all the general pathologists believed that oral pathologists should be part of the team.
CONCLUSION
The general pathologists recognized oral pathology as a specialty and feel the need for an oral pathologist opinion in diagnosis. However, most of the general pathologists did not refer the complex cases to oral pathologists. Therefore, it is of paramount importance to encourage oral pathologists and their hiring at histopathology laboratories that are diagnosing complex head and neck cases.

OBJECTIVE
To explore the feasibility and effectiveness of mixed reality technology for localizing perforator vessels in the repair of mandibular defects using free fibular flap.
METHODS
Between June 2020 and June 2023, 12 patients with mandibular defects were repaired with free fibular flap. There were 8 males and 4 females, with an average age of 61 years (range, 35-78 years). There were 9 cases of ameloblastomas and 3 cases of squamous cell carcinomas involving the mandible. The disease duration ranged from 15 days to 2 years (median, 14.2 months). The length of mandibular defects ranged from 5 to 14 cm (mean, 8.5 cm). The area of soft tissue defects ranged from 5 cm×4 cm to 8 cm×6 cm. Preoperative enhanced CT scans of the maxillofacial region and CT angiography of the lower limbs were performed, and the data was used to create three-dimensional models of the mandible and lower limb perforator vessels. During operation, the mixed reality technology was used to overlay the three-dimensional model of perforator vessels onto the body surface for harvesting the free fibular flap. The length of the fibula harvested ranged from 6 to 15 cm, with a mean of 9.5 cm; the size of the flap ranged from 6 cm×5 cm to 10 cm×8 cm. The donor sites were sutured directly in 7 cases and repaired with free skin grafting in 5 cases.
RESULTS
Thirty perforator vessels were located by mixed reality technology before operation, with an average of 2.5 vessels per case; the distance between the exit point of the perforator vessels located before operation and the actual exit point ranged from 1 to 4 mm, with a mean of 2.8 mm. All fibular flaps survived; 1 case had necrosis at the distal end of flap, which healed after dressing changes. One donor site had infection, which healed after anti-inflammatory dressing changes; the remaining incisions healed by first intention, and the grafts survived smoothly. All patients were followed up 8-36 months (median, 21 months). The repaired facial appearance was satisfactory, with no flap swelling. Among the patients underwent postoperative radiotherapy, 2 patients had normal bone healing and 1 had delayed healing at 6 months.
CONCLUSION
In free fibular flap reconstruction of mandibular defects, the use of mixed reality technology for perforator vessel localization can achieve three-dimensional visualization, simplify surgical procedures, and reduce errors.

Orofacial masses or swellings are a common presenting complaint in lagomorphs. Similar gross appearances of the masses can complicate clinical interpretation, and histologic review often provides the final diagnosis. Underlying causes vary from infectious to neoplastic. Although inflammatory changes are most commonly reported, various neoplasms occur, although the prevalence of specific tumor types is relatively unknown. We reviewed retrospectively 120 cases (87.5% biopsy, 12.5% autopsy) of neoplastic and non-neoplastic orofacial masses received from January 2000-February 2023 at 2 institutions: University of Guelph, Canada (Animal Health Laboratory and Department of Pathobiology), and Finn Pathologists, United Kingdom. All final diagnoses were achieved through histologic assessment. We included masses or mass-like swellings from the oral cavity, including the mandible and maxilla, and surrounding skin and soft tissues of the oral cavity and jaw. Submissions included pet and commercial (meat and fur) rabbits. Neoplastic lesions were most common (60%), including trichoblastomas, papillomas, melanocytic neoplasms, sarcomas, round-cell tumors, carcinomas (including squamous cell carcinoma), lipomas, odontogenic neoplasms, polyps, osteoma, neuroma, peripheral keratinizing ameloblastoma, and apocrine adenoma. Inflammatory diagnoses (30%) included abscesses, osteomyelitis, dermatitis, and sialadenitis. Other diagnoses (7%) included cysts, as well as hyperplastic skin and proliferative bone lesions. Three cases had no definitive diagnosis. The importance of histologic assessment in diagnosing orofacial "masses" in rabbits is highlighted, given that the most common diagnostic category overall was neoplasia.
